Transaction 833ccd56759e1db49556ed35c29b21944b70174101bcfd9618be9109f6eb5c1b
1 Input
1 Output
-
833ccd56759e1db49556ed35c29b21944b70174101bcfd9618be9109f6eb5c1b:0
- value
- 17425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 216c928f8185239535d0f052a28050b3cd231974 OP_EQUAL
- address
- 34jkHd8vrS3ADD1Vavjsov85VueGMf69fn